Chrome doesn't allow dragging when zoomed in to large images

Reported by 93m4qau...@gmail.com, Jan 12 2018

Issue description

UserAgent: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ows NT 6.1; Win64; x64) AppleWebKit/537.36 (KHTML, like Gecko) Chrome/63.0.3239.132 Safari/537.36

Example URL:

Steps to reproduce the problem:
1. Open an image that is too large to fit on the screen at once.
2. Click on the image to zoom into it at 100% level.
3. Try to drag the image around.

What is the expected behavior?
You can drag the image around once zoomed in, just like you can in Windows Photo Viewer.

What went wrong?
At least there is a scrollbar now, but the functionality to drag the image around once zoomed in is still missing.

Updating component. This isn't about drag/drop of data, but indeed a feature request to change the behavior when zoomed in to *not* do drag/drop but pan the image instead.

It'snot clear we will change this. The drag-and-drop functionality takes priority over the panning functionality because it has no alternate pathway, whereas you can always use the scrollbars to pan.

It does seem like we could do better, however, so leaving the issue open.
